    An excellent beach with lots of sand and a pier.

    An excellent beach with lots of sand and a pier. The funicular railway from the beach to the top was not working owing to a fire. There are good walks from the sea up the valley which is served by a miniature railway from Easter.

    Lovely little town great views plenty of parking.

    Lovely little town great views plenty of parking. The Saltburn Cliff Lift was out of action due to fire after recent renovations but a sight to see as its one of the worlds oldest water powered funiculars
